Question

Two insulated charged copper spheres A and B have their centers separated by a distance of 50 cm. What is the mutual force of electrostatic repulsion if the charge on each is 6.5×1076.5 \times 10^{-7} C? (The radii of A and B are negligible compared to the distance of separation.)

A

1.52×1021.52 \times 10^{-2} N

B

3.7×1023.7 \times 10^{-2} N

C

2.01×1022.01 \times 10^{-2} N

D

2.23×1012.23 \times 10^{-1} N
